37 plastic units flouting ban: KSPCB

Officials of the Karnataka State Pollution Control Board (KSPCB) have found as many as 37 plastic units in the City violating the government orders on ban of plastic.

Following the blanket ban on plastic, the KSPCB inspected 80 plastic units in the City from March 23 to 29. Of the six units inspected in Peenya, all were found to be violating the rules while of the 14 units checked in Peenya, six had not complied with the ban orders.

Officials from Rajarajeshwari regional office found two units violating the ban while it was seven in Bengaluru west and 44 units in Bengaluru south. No unit was found violating the rules in Bengaluru east, a press release said.
